When a car drives through the Earth’s magnetic field, an emf is induced in its vertical 60-cm-long radio antenna. Part A If the Earth’s field (5.0×10−5 T) points north with a dip angle of 38∘, which direction(s) will the car be moving to produce the maximum emf induced in the antenna?

    The magnetic field is in north south direction . In order to cut lines of forces to the maximum extent  , car has to move in east- west direction ie towards east or towards west to produce maximum emf.

    emf produced = B L V

    where B is horizontal component of earth magnetic field

    L is length of rod

    v is velocity of car carrying antenna rod .
